Fundraising Overview - The company raised a total of RMB 529.21 million by issuing 14.857116 million shares at a price of RMB 35.62 per share, with all funds received by May 31, 2022 [1] - The funds are managed in a dedicated account, and a tripartite supervision agreement was initially signed with the sponsor and the bank [1] Change in Fundraising Projects - On June 3, 2025, the company held a shareholder meeting to approve the termination of certain fundraising projects and the reallocation of remaining funds [2] - A total of RMB 219.25 million, including RMB 112.45 million from the original project and RMB 106.80 million of unused excess funds, will be redirected to a new project for producing 10,000 sets of intelligent logistics equipment [2] New Fund Management Agreement - A four-party supervision agreement was signed involving the company, its wholly-owned subsidiary, the bank, and the sponsor to regulate the management and use of the raised funds [3] - The new dedicated account is specifically for the new project and cannot be used for other purposes [5] Key Provisions of the Agreement - The agreement stipulates that the subsidiary must manage the funds in accordance with relevant laws and regulations [5] - The sponsor is responsible for ongoing supervision of the fund usage and must conduct semi-annual inspections [6] - The bank is required to provide monthly account statements to both the company and the sponsor [6] Agreement Validity - The agreement becomes effective upon signing and remains valid until all funds are fully utilized and the account is closed [7]

Group 1 - China Bank Shanxi Branch has developed a comprehensive financial innovation service system to support technology-based enterprises, aiming to inject continuous momentum into the innovation development of Shanxi's tech sector, with over 100 billion yuan in loans projected by May 2025 [1] - Shanxi Jiashida Robot Technology Co., Ltd. transformed from a small R&D team into a national-level specialized "little giant" enterprise, receiving 3 million yuan in credit loans during critical development phases, with credit support increasing to nearly 70 million yuan over ten years [2] - In January, China Bank announced a plan to provide no less than 1 trillion yuan in financial support for the AI industry chain over the next five years, with Shanxi Branch already providing nearly 500 million yuan to over ten AI enterprises by May 2025 [3] Group 2 - Taiyuan Fulairida Logistics Equipment Technology Co., Ltd. received 50 million yuan in funding from China Bank Shanxi Branch, enabling the development of advanced smart warehousing systems and equipment, enhancing operational efficiency and promoting low-carbon storage solutions [4] - Datong has become a significant data center hub, with over 204,000 large-scale data centers and more than 3 million servers supporting high-tech industries, showcasing the city's transformation from coal mining to data processing [5] - China Bank Shanxi Branch tailored financial products for Datong's enterprises facing funding challenges, simplifying approval processes and reducing financing costs, with nearly 500 million yuan in loans issued to a specific data service company by May 2025 [6][7]
